Yes, Ja...Estela - Glad that it was helpful to you! Yes, January is usually a good time for skiing here, and even if there isn't much snow on the ground, every resort has its own snow-making equipment. It goes without saying that weekends and holidays are most crowded. Early in the morning is usually very peaceful. And yes, you can rent clothing - ski pants, jackets are readily available for rental - I am pretty certain gloves and goggles, too, but I'm not sure. You'll need warm socks hats, neckwarmers, and underlayers, of course, but the actual ski stuff is there for rental in all sizes.
